what is this med for? ## side effects from propandol and if missed for one day side effects ## Propranolol is a beta blocker that's most commonly used to treat high blood pressure and certain cardiac conditions. It may cause side effects, such as nausea, dizziness, headache and hypotension. Learn more Propranolol details here. And you should make sure not to miss doses of this medication, because doing so could result in a rebound effect, which may cause dangerously elevated heart rate and blood pressure.
